Simon Property Group, Inc. EPS (Earnings per Share) 2007–2025
Simon Property Group, Inc. reported $14.17 of earnings per share for fiscal 2025. That was 95.2% higher than fiscal 2024.
| Fiscal year | EPS (Earnings per Share) | Change (YoY) |
|---|---|---|
| FY 2025 | $14.17 | +95.2% |
| FY 2024 | $7.26 | +4.0% |
| FY 2023 | $6.98 | +7.1% |
| FY 2022 | $6.52 | -4.7% |
| FY 2021 | $6.84 | — |
